About The Position

A Driver/ Tech or Propane Specialist is responsible for the safe and timely tank setup and/or delivery of products to our customers. The Propane Specialist will install/repair tanks, deliver, load and unload propane into the bulk truck and end use containers while providing exceptional customer service. A Propane Specialist will also be accountable for upholding the highest standards for safety in the delivery and handling of propane and for conducting regular vehicle inspections and maintenance.

Requirements

  • High school diploma or equivalent
  • Minimum of one (1) year job related (Propane) experience
  • CDL Class A or B with Tanker & Hazmat
  • Clean drivers abstract
  • Up-to-date DOT medical certification
  • Willingness to rotate 'on call' status during evenings and weekends as needed.

Responsibilities

  • Transfer, collect, load, and deliver propane products to and from containers (bulk truck, tanks, and/or cylinders) for customers.
  • Initiate and conduct the asset verification process.
  • Collect customer signatures/stamps and payments for deposit if necessary.
  • Offer customer brochures with basic price lists and a contact number.
  • Maintain a clean and organized vehicle.
  • Leverage technology to monitor and track the transfer of propane inventory, tank levels and container sizing.
  • Accurately record and print delivery tickets for customers for product delivered.
  • Accurately complete and submit daily driver reports where necessary.
  • Maintain equipment to the highest level of safety standards, reporting any mechanical issues to the Fleet Manager/Dispatcher.
  • Conduct and document pre and post vehicle inspections, site inspections and visual tank inspections.
  • Collaborate with the Dispatcher frequently for routing and scheduling information.
  • Notify the Dispatcher of any product, customer, routing, scheduling, or safety issues immediately.
  • Provide Propane tank installations in a timely manner, ensuring compliance with all state/local codes and safety policies.
  • Identify and correct any leaks from the tank to equipment connection.
  • Respond to customer emergencies as needed.
  • Complete tank inspections and repairs at customer locations.
  • Perform tank maintenance on spare tanks in preparation of installation.
